Output 9ae2f5580df8c35498a2144c18a7a1183d80afd7e9ee310461d643a21295800e:3

value
40435907
script pubkey
OP_HASH160 OP_PUSHBYTES_20 babb81eb5dd71ca5f1452cd6992ccd3958c31600 OP_EQUAL
address
MQvWYMqEr1DC4uKXnKxf1ofCfSSdVXg86Y
transaction
9ae2f5580df8c35498a2144c18a7a1183d80afd7e9ee310461d643a21295800e
spent
true